Creates chord diagrams for connectivity/graph data

Project description

NiChord is a Python package for visualizing functional connectivity data. This package was inspired by NeuroMArVL, an online visualization tool.

The code can function with any configuration of edges and labels specified by the user.

The glass brain diagrams (left & middle) rely on the plotting tools from nilearn, whereas the chord diagram (right) is made from scratch by drawing shapes in matplotlib. Most of the code, here, is dedicated to the chord diagrams.

This package additionally provides code to help assign labels to nodes based on their anatomical location.
